Sea Surface Temperature Anomalies: A Possible Trigger for ENSO

Sea Surface Temperature Anomalies: A Possible Trigger for ENSO

In this study, a modified multi-dimensional ensemble empirical mode decomposition (MEEMD) is devised and employed to understand the temporal-spatial evolution of the sea surface temperature anomalies (SSTAs) of interannual timescales.
